On the 28th June, 1943 Flying Officer Mann was a member of the crew of a Wellington bomber which crashed into Solway Firth. An immediate search was made for survivors but no trace was found of Flying Officer Mann who was consequently classified as missing believed downed. His death was confirmed when his body was recovered on the 3rd August, 1943 and he was buried on the 26th August, at Silloth, Cumberland.
